On the evening of May 27, 2024, NIO officially launched the ES9, with a starting price of RMB 498,000. With NIO’s Battery as a Service (BaaS) option, the entry price drops to RMB 390,000. On the same day, the new AITO M9 also debuted in Shenzhen. Both models are positioned as premium flagship SUVs in the RMB 500,000 segment, targeting highly overlapping customer groups and directly competing with each other in product positioning. The NIO ES9 is a full-size, all-electric executive flagship SUV, measuring 5,365 mm in length with a 3,250 mm wheelbase. It offers over 2.8 meters of longitudinal cabin space, up to 1.2 meters of legroom in the second row, and a trunk capacity of 800 liters even when fully occupied. The vehicle features a 216-liter front trunk and an ultra-low ground clearance stepboard at just 19 cm, emphasizing the practicality of its native EV spatial layout. In terms of chassis technology, the ES9 is equipped with the world’s first mass-produced Tianting 48V integrated fully active suspension system, which responds in under 6 milliseconds and supports active vibration cancellation and preview-based damping. It also features steer-by-wire, rear-wheel steering (achieving a minimum turning radius of 5.4 meters), NIO’s self-developed VSC vehicle dynamics control system, and multiple terrain driving modes. In contrast, the AITO M9 employs an 800V fully active suspension, dual-valve continuously variable damping shock absorbers, and a dual-chamber air suspension system. For luxury amenities, the ES9 comes with “Flying Zero-Gravity” seats featuring a 17-layer structure, 22-point deep-tissue massage, and mechanical foot massage. Its side windows utilize array-based LC smart privacy dimming technology with a 99.8% light-blocking rate. Interior highlights include dual 16-inch executive screens, an 8.8-liter smart refrigerator, and dual wing-style executive tray tables. The audio system—named “Jiuxiao Tianqing”—boasts 47 speakers and is complemented by advanced NVH engineering for exceptional cabin quietness. On the intelligence front, the ES9 is powered by NIO’s self-developed AD chip Shenji NX9031 and the SkyOS·Tianshu vehicle operating system. It features the NOMI Intelligence 4.0 voice interaction system with an emotion engine. Its ADAS suite, the “Aquila HyperSense System,” integrates 31 high-performance sensors and leverages NIO’s World Model (NWM) to enable point-to-point urban and highway navigation assistance, battery-swap navigation, intelligent parking, and comprehensive safety assistance functions. To date, this system has helped avoid or mitigate over 5.7 million incidents. For energy replenishment, the ES9 leverages NIO’s battery swap ecosystem, supporting seamless 3-minute battery swaps. Built on a 900V high-voltage platform with a 102 kWh battery pack, it delivers a CLTC range of 620 km. At launch, NIO operated more than 3,800 battery swap stations nationwide and plans to add over 1,000 more by year-end. The BaaS program further lowers the barrier to entry for buyers. The AITO M9, meanwhile, offers diverse powertrain options to cater to a broader user base. The NIO ES9 focuses squarely on native electric driving experience and the advantages of battery swapping. The two vehicles thus pursue differentiated strategies in technical approach, usage scenarios, and user experience—jointly driving China’s premium SUV market toward greater systematization, technological sophistication, and experiential excellence.
